How Services Operate in Turkey During Ramazan Bayram 2026

Ramazan Bayram is one of the main religious holidays in Turkey, marking the end of the fasting month. During this period, the operating hours of transportation, government offices, and businesses change across the country, which is important to consider for both residents and tourists.

📅 official holiday dates: March 19 (Arife, half-day) · March 20–22 (full public holidays)

🚇 Public Transport in Istanbul

From March 20 to 22, rides on public transport are free when using a personalized İstanbulkart.

This applies to:

  • Metro
  • Metrobuses
  • Buses
  • Trams
  • City ferries
🎫 free public transport in Istanbul: March 20–22 with personalized İstanbulkart – metro, metrobus, bus, tram, ferry.

🏥 Hospitals

During the holidays, only emergency departments (ACİL) and on-call services operate. Scheduled appointments and outpatient clinics will not be available.

💊 pharmacies: Only on-duty pharmacies (nöbetçi eczane) are open during the holiday.

💸 Banks and Government Offices

  • March 20–22 – fully closed
  • March 19 – operating on a shortened schedule

📦 Cargo and Delivery Services

Most services operate on a limited schedule. Full operations resume after the holiday.

🛒 Shops and Shopping Centers

  • March 20 – open later than usual (around 12:00)
  • March 21–22 – mostly standard working hours
💱 currency exchange: Exchange offices in tourist areas continue to operate even during the holidays – convenient for travelers.
